As the hearty aroma of a bubbling casserole fills the kitchen, I can’t help but feel a warm rush of nostalgia. This Ground Beef Zucchini Casserole is more than just dinner; it’s a deliciously satisfying meal that transforms busy weeknights into comforting moments for the whole family. Loaded with protein-packed ground beef and tender zucchini, this low-carb recipe serves up a nutritious twist that sneaks in those extra veggies everyone needs. Plus, it’s incredibly customizable, allowing you to adapt it to your loved ones’ tastes. Whether you’re hopping off work or wrangling kids, this easy-to-make dish will have you enjoying homemade goodness in no time. Are you ready to dive into this cheesy, savory hug of a casserole?

Why is this casserole a must-try?
Comforting Simplicity: This Ground Beef Zucchini Casserole wraps flavor and ease into one dish, perfect for busy nights.
Nutritious Twist: Packed with protein and veggies, it’s a healthy alternative to traditional casseroles, making it family-friendly and low-carb.
Customizable Goodness: Feel free to swap in your favorite vegetables or cheeses, creating a personalized dish everyone will enjoy!
Quick Prep Time: With just a few easy steps, this recipe saves time in the kitchen—ideal for those hectic weeknights.
Crowd-Pleasing Delight: Its cheesy, savory profile makes it a hit with both kids and adults, reminiscent of hearty comfort food without the carbs.
Pair this with a refreshing salad or crusty bread for an even more satisfying meal!
Ground Beef Zucchini Casserole Ingredients
For the Casserole
• Ground Beef – The star of the dish providing essential protein; lean ground beef is great for a healthier option.
• Zucchini – Offers moisture and texture; fresh zucchini is best, but canned can work if drained properly.
• Onion – Builds a flavor foundation; substitute with shallots for a milder sweetness.
• Garlic – Enhances flavor; fresh minced garlic adds the best taste profile.
• Crushed Tomatoes – Provides moisture and a tangy base; feel free to swap with diced tomatoes for a chunkier texture.
• Italian Seasoning – Infuses herbs and spices; you can also use individual herbs like basil and oregano if needed.
• Salt & Black Pepper – Essential for seasoning; adjust to meet your taste preferences.
• Cheddar Cheese – Melts beautifully for richness; mozzarella can be used for a different melty flavor.
• Parmesan Cheese – Adds a delightful crunch to the topping when baked; it’s a flavor enhancer for your casserole.
• Eggs – Binds the casserole together, providing structure; for a dairy-free option, substitute with cream and add extra cheese.
• Olive Oil – Ideal for sautéing; swap it out with butter for a touch of indulgence.
Here’s a hearty, crowd-pleasing dish that will leave everyone asking for seconds and sneaking in those extra veggies. Enjoy crafting your Ground Beef Zucchini Casserole!
Step‑by‑Step Instructions for Ground Beef Zucchini Casserole
Step 1: Preheat Oven
Begin by preheating your oven to 350°F (175°C). This will ensure your Ground Beef Zucchini Casserole cooks evenly and reaches the perfect bubbly, golden-brown finish. While the oven heats up, grab a medium-sized baking dish and lightly grease it with olive oil or cooking spray to prevent sticking.
Step 2: Sauté Aromatics
In a large skillet, heat 1 tablespoon of olive oil over medium heat. Add 1 chopped onion and 2 cloves of minced garlic, sautéing for about 3-5 minutes until the onion turns translucent and fragrant. This aromatic mixture will form a delightful base for your casserole, filling your kitchen with a rich flavor that beckons.
Step 3: Brown Beef
Add 1 pound of lean ground beef to the skillet with the sautéed onion and garlic. Cook until the beef is browned and no longer pink, approximately 5-7 minutes, breaking it apart with a spatula as it cooks. Drain any excess fat if needed, preserving that savory flavor while making your dish lighter.
Step 4: Combine Ingredients
Stir in a can of crushed tomatoes, 1 tablespoon of Italian seasoning, and salt and pepper to taste into the beef mixture. Let this savory blend simmer for an additional 2-3 minutes on low heat, allowing the flavors to meld together beautifully. You’ll notice the sauce thickening slightly and smelling divine!
Step 5: Prepare Zucchini
While the meat mixture cooks, slice or shred 2 medium zucchinis into thin rounds or ribbons. If you choose to use raw zucchini, remember to sprinkle them with salt and let them sit for about 10 minutes to draw out excess moisture. This prevents your casserole from becoming soggy, ensuring a delightful texture.
Step 6: Layer Casserole
In your greased baking dish, start layering your Ground Beef Zucchini Casserole. First, create a base with the zucchini, followed by the beef mixture, and then generously sprinkle with a combination of 1 cup of shredded cheddar cheese and ½ cup of grated Parmesan cheese. The cheese will create a melty topping that everyone will love!
Step 7: Mix Eggs
In a separate bowl, whisk together 2 large eggs until well blended. Pour this mixture evenly over the top of the layered casserole. The eggs will help bind everything together as it bakes, creating a satisfying, cohesive dish that holds its shape beautifully when served.
Step 8: Bake
Place the baking dish in the preheated oven and bake for 30 minutes. You’ll know your casserole is done when the cheese is bubbly and golden, and the egg has set. The enticing aroma will fill your home, promising a delicious family dinner awaits.
Step 9: Let Cool
Once baked, remove the casserole from the oven and let it cool for 5-10 minutes. This short resting period allows it to set further and makes for easier slicing. Once cooled, slice into portions and serve, enjoying each cheesy, savory bite of your Ground Beef Zucchini Casserole!

Ground Beef Zucchini Casserole Variations
Feel free to get creative and make this Ground Beef Zucchini Casserole uniquely yours!
-
Turkey Swap: Replace ground beef with ground turkey for a leaner option without losing flavor. It’s equally hearty and delicious!
-
Veggie Boost: Add colorful bell peppers, diced spinach, or even sautéed mushrooms to enhance the veggie content and flavor. Each bite will be a delightful surprise!
-
Dairy-Free Delight: Make it dairy-free by swapping cheeses with vegan alternatives like nutritional yeast or cashew cheese. You’ll still enjoy a rich and creamy texture.
-
Zesty Heat: For a spicy kick, mix in crushed red pepper flakes or diced jalapeños. It’s a fun way to warm up the dish while appealing to heat lovers.
-
Low-Carb Flatbreads: Serve slices on a bed of your favorite low-carb flatbreads or lettuce wraps for a satisfying, hands-on meal that feels indulgent yet guilt-free.
-
Herb Infusion: Refresh the flavor by sprinkling fresh herbs like basil or parsley on top before serving. This will brighten the dish and add a burst of color!
-
Crunchy Topping: Add a layer of crushed pork rinds or low-carb breadcrumbs mixed with smoked paprika on top before baking for an extra crunch that tantalizes the taste buds.
These variations offer delightful twists, ensuring that this cozy casserole never gets old. For another comforting dish, you might also love my Chicken Noodle Casserole or explore the richness of Beef Bourguignon Savor. Happy cooking!
Make Ahead Options
These Ground Beef Zucchini Casserole preparations are perfect for busy weeknights! You can sauté the onion, garlic, and ground beef mixture up to 3 days in advance and store it in an airtight container in the refrigerator. Additionally, you can slice or shred your zucchini, salting it lightly to draw out moisture, and refrigerate it overnight as well. When you’re ready to serve, simply layer the ingredients in your prepared baking dish, whisk the eggs, and top with cheese before baking—all set to pop in the oven for a delightful family meal that feels just as fresh as if it were made the same day!
What to Serve with Ground Beef Zucchini Casserole
As the warmth of your Ground Beef Zucchini Casserole fills the air, consider these delightful pairings to create a memorable dinner experience.
-
Garlic Bread: The perfect companion, providing a crunchy contrast that soaks up the casserole’s rich flavors.
-
Mixed Green Salad: A refreshing balance, this salad adds crunch and color, and the vinaigrette cuts through the cheese’s richness.
-
Roasted Vegetables: Seasonal veggies enhance nutrition and flavor, adding a delightful roasted aroma alongside the casserole.
-
Coleslaw: This crispy side offers a tangy crunch that brightens each bite of the savory casserole.
-
Cauliflower Rice: A low-carb alternative to traditional rice, it’s a light and fluffy base that complements the hearty casserole beautifully.
-
Chilled White Wine: A glass of chilled Sauvignon Blanc can elevate your meal, offering a crisp contrast to the grilled flavors.
Dive in and let the comfort of a home-cooked meal shine through every bite!
Storage Tips for Ground Beef Zucchini Casserole
Fridge: Store leftovers in an airtight container for up to 4 days. Make sure to let it cool completely before sealing to maintain freshness.
Freezer: For longer storage, freeze the casserole for up to 2 months. Cut it into portions for easier reheating later.
Reheating: To enjoy your Ground Beef Zucchini Casserole again, thaw it overnight in the fridge and reheat in the oven at 350°F (175°C) until warm (about 20 minutes).
Covering: Always cover the casserole with foil while reheating to keep it moist, preventing it from drying out during the process.
Expert Tips for Ground Beef Zucchini Casserole
-
Drain Zucchini: To avoid a watery casserole, always salt and drain your zucchini before adding it to the mix. This step is vital!
-
Cook Beef Properly: Browning the ground beef is essential. Ensure it’s cooked through but avoid overcooking to keep it juicy and flavorful.
-
Cheese Choices: While cheddar is classic, don’t hesitate to experiment with different cheeses like mozzarella or even a spicy pepper jack for a kick!
-
Layering Technique: Layering zucchini first helps prevent it from getting mushy. Make sure to spread the beef mixture evenly for consistent flavor in every bite!
-
Add Greens: For extra nutrition, sneak in some chopped spinach or bell peppers into the beef mixture—your family will thank you, and they won’t even notice the extra veggies!
-
Storage Tips: This Ground Beef Zucchini Casserole reheats beautifully. Store leftovers in an airtight container, and they’ll taste just as delicious the next day!

Ground Beef Zucchini Casserole Recipe FAQs
How can I ensure my zucchini is the right texture for the casserole?
To achieve the best texture, I recommend salting and draining the zucchini before using it. Sprinkle salt over sliced zucchini, let it sit for about 10 minutes, and then pat it dry with a paper towel. This process helps eliminate excess moisture, preventing your casserole from becoming soggy.
What’s the best way to store leftovers of the Ground Beef Zucchini Casserole?
Store your leftovers in an airtight container in the fridge for up to 4 days. It’s best to let the casserole cool completely before sealing to maintain its freshness. If you wish to keep it longer, consider freezing it.
Can I freeze the Ground Beef Zucchini Casserole?
Absolutely! You can freeze the casserole for up to 2 months. I suggest cutting it into individual portions for easier reheating. When you’re ready to enjoy it, thaw overnight in the fridge and then reheat in the oven at 350°F (175°C) for about 20 minutes until warmed through.
What should I do if my casserole turns out too watery?
If you find your casserole watery, ensure you properly drain the zucchini before adding it to the mixture. Additionally, using lean ground beef and simmering the beef mixture to let excess moisture evaporate can help. For added thickness, consider mixing in a tablespoon of tomato paste or adding a bit of cooked rice or quinoa.
Are there any dietary considerations I should keep in mind for this recipe?
Yes! This casserole is a great option for those on a low-carb diet. However, if you have cheese allergies or lactose intolerance, you can substitute the cheeses with dairy-free alternatives. Also, if you plan to share this dish with pets, remember to check for any dietary restrictions; for instance, onions and garlic can be harmful to dogs.
How can I customize the Ground Beef Zucchini Casserole to my family’s preferences?
The more the merrier when it comes to customization! Feel free to add your family’s favorite veggies, such as bell peppers or spinach, and adjust the cheese to match your taste. You can also swap ground beef for ground turkey or chicken for a lighter option. Don’t hesitate to add spices like red pepper flakes for a little kick!

Ground Beef Zucchini Casserole for a Cozy Family Dinner
Ingredients
Equipment
Method
- Preheat your oven to 350°F (175°C) and grease a medium-sized baking dish with olive oil.
- In a skillet, heat 1 tablespoon of olive oil over medium heat. Add 1 chopped onion and 2 minced garlic cloves, sauté for 3-5 minutes until onion is translucent.
- Add 1 pound of lean ground beef to the skillet, cooking until browned for 5-7 minutes. Drain any excess fat if needed.
- Stir in 1 can of crushed tomatoes, 1 tablespoon of Italian seasoning, salt, and pepper to taste. Let simmer for 2-3 minutes.
- Slice or shred 2 medium zucchinis and lightly salt them, letting them sit for 10 minutes to draw out moisture.
- Layer your casserole: start with zucchini, then beef mixture, and top with 1 cup of cheddar cheese and ½ cup of parmesan cheese.
- In a bowl, whisk 2 large eggs. Pour this evenly over the layered casserole.
- Bake in the oven for 30 minutes until cheese is bubbly and golden, and egg is set.
- Let the casserole cool for 5-10 minutes before slicing and serving.

Leave a Reply